WebbThe ends of the principal fibers that are within the cementum or alveolar bone proper are called Sharpey fibers. Transseptal fibers. Transseptal fibers (H) extend over the alveolar bone crest and are embedded in the cementum of adjacent teeth where they form an interdental ligament. These fibers work to keep the teeth aligned.

WebbSharpey fibers are portions of the principal collagen fibers of the periodontal ligament embedded in cementum and alveolar bone to attach the tooth to the alveolus (Fig. 1.28 ). Cementum is avascular. Cementum is yellow and slightly lighter in color than dentin. In particular, the regeneration of periodontal tissues or tooth-supportive structures is still challenging to spatiotemporally … WebbPrincipal fibers other than the alveolodental ligament are the transseptal fibers. All these fibers help the tooth withstand the naturally substantial compressive forces which occur during chewing and remain embedded in the bone. The ends of the principal fibers that are within either cementum or alveolar bone proper are considered Sharpey fibers.

Webb7 jan. 2024 · Comparison of periodontium and peri-implant soft tissue characteristics. (a) Sharpey’s fibers attach to the cementum of natural teeth and are oriented perpendicular to the tooth surface. (b) Peri-implant connective tissue is primarily oriented parallel or circumferentially to the abutment surface.
